使用Java调用IBM i(OS/400)命令的示例代码

作者:佚名 上传时间:2023-04-25 运行软件:AS/400 Toolbox for Java 软件版本:IBM i 7.3 版权申诉

本示例展示了如何使用Java代码调用IBM i(OS/400)命令,以及如何处理该命令返回的结果。

import com.ibm.as400.access.AS400;
import com.ibm.as400.access.CommandCall;

public class CommandCallExample {
    public static void main(String[] args) {
        try {
            AS400 as400 = new AS400("host_name", "user_name", "password");
            CommandCall cmd = new CommandCall(as400);
            String command = "WRKSPLF FILE(QPRINT) OUTFILE(QTEMP/WORKFILE)";
            boolean success = cmd.run(command);
            if (success) {
                System.out.println("命令已成功执行!");
            } else {
                System.out.println("命令执行失败!");
            }
        } catch (Exception e) {
            e.printStackTrace();
        }
    }
}

该示例使用了IBM提供的Java类库——AS/400 Toolbox for Java。首先通过AS/400类创建了一个AS/400对象,然后使用CommandCall类执行了一个命令并检查命令是否成功执行。

免责申明:文章和图片全部来源于公开网络,如有侵权,请通知删除 server@dude6.com

用户评论
相关推荐
使用Java调用IBM iOS/400命令示例代码
本示例展示了如何使用Java代码调用IBM i(OS/400)命令,以及如何处理该命令返回的结果。import com.ibm.as400.access.AS400;import com.ibm.
IBM i 7.3
AS/400 Toolbox for Java
2023-04-25 08:44
使用ibm i (os/400)命令调用远程web服务
本示例展示如何使用ibm i (os/400)中的CL命令来调用远程web服务,并通过带有用户名和密码的HTTP标头进行身份验证。/*调用远程web服务*/ PGM
IBM i 7.4
IBM i Access Client Solutions
2023-04-29 23:40
使用IBM i (OS/400)执行远程命令示例代码
通过IBM i (OS/400)提供的远程命令功能,可以在远程机器上执行命令。这个示例代码演示了如何在IBM i (OS/400)上执行远程命令。import com.ibm.as400.acces
IBM i (OS/400) v7.2
AS/400 Toolbox for Java
2023-04-29 02:05
IBM i (OS/400)示例代码
本文提供IBM i (OS/400)开发实例、网络编程示例和数据库操作示例的示例代码,并对代码进行释义和总结。IBM i (OS/400)开发实例示例1: 打印当前日期和时间//RPGLE程序
7.4.0
IBM公司
2023-03-31 06:47
IBM i (OS/400)中使用CL程序调用Java代码
本示例演示了如何在IBM i (OS/400)中使用CL程序调用Java代码。需要安装Java 8及以上版本。该示例可以帮助开发人员在IBM i上使用Java的特性。/*开发CL程序*/PGM
IBM i 7.4
IBM Rational Developer for i
2023-03-18 20:40
使用IBM i (OS/400)执行CL命令示例
IBM i,先前称为OS/400,是IBM的操作系统,广泛用于企业中的中间件和数据库应用程序。在IBM i上,您可以使用CL(Control Language)编写和执行操作系统命令。以下示例演示了如
IBM i 7.4
IBM i Control Language(CL)
2023-10-22 07:33
使用IBM i (OS/400)创建表示例代码
简单介绍了如何在IBM i (OS/400)上创建一个表,包括指定表名、定义字段和设置主键等信息。// 创建一个名为CUSTOMERS的表// 指定主键为CUST_ID// 定义两个字段:CUS
IBM i (OS/400) V7R1
IBM i (OS/400)
2023-04-28 05:08
IBM i (OS/400)基础编程示例代码
本文为IBM i系统开发入门提供示例代码和相应的代码释义,旨在帮助读者更好地理解OS/400程序设计,以及提供IBM i开发指南。以下是本文的总结:本文主要介绍了IBM i (OS/400)基础编程
7.4
IBM i开发平台
2023-03-23 07:13
处理IBM i (OS/400)文件示例代码
该示例代码演示如何使用IBM i (OS/400)上的RPGLE编程语言来读取、写入、更新和删除文件。使用的是带有DSPF的交互式用户界面。在该程序中,可以建立一个文件记录,并可以根据不同的条件对查询
IBM i (OS/400) V7R1M0
RPGLE
2023-05-19 03:43
IBM i (OS/400) 上使用 RPG 语言调用 Web 服务示例代码
本示例展示了如何在 IBM i (OS/400) 上使用 RPG 语言调用 Web 服务。通过使用 IBM Toolbox for Java 中的 JT400 API,我们可以轻松地与 Web 服务进
IBM i 7.3
RPG IV
2023-03-23 07:36